112th CONGRESS
1st Session
H. R. 2292To amend title II of the Social Security Act
to eliminate the two-year waiting period for divorced spouse's benefits following
the divorce.
IN TH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VESJune
22, 2011
Mrs. LOWEY introduced the following bill; which was referred
to the Committee on Ways and Means
A BILLTo
amend title II of the Social Security Act to eliminate the two-year waiting period
for divorced spouse's benefits following the divorce.
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States
of America in Congress assembled,
SECTION 1. EXEMPTION FROM
TWO-YEAR WAITING PERIOD FOR DIVORCED SPOUSE'S BENEFITS FOLLOWING THE DIVORCE IN
CASES OF PRIOR RECEIPT OF SPOUSE'S BENEFITS.
(a) Wife's Insurance
Benefits- Section 202(b)(4)(A) of the Social Security Act (42 U.S.C. 402(b)(4)(A))
is amended by striking `divorced wife--' and all that follows through `shall be
entitled' and inserting `divorced wife meets the requirements of subparagraphs
(A) through (D) of paragraph (1), shall be entitled'.
(b) Husband's
Insurance Benefits- Section 202(c)(4)(A) of such Act (42 U.S.C. 402(c)(4)(A))
is amended by striking `divorced husband--' and all that follows through `shall
be entitled' and inserting `divorced husband meets the requirements of subparagraphs
(A) through (D) of paragraph (1), shall be entitled'.
(c) Exemption
From Deductions on Account of Work- Section 203(b)(2) of such Act (42 U.S.C. 403(b)(2))
is amended--
(1) by striking `(2)(A) Except as' and all that
follows through `the benefit to which' and inserting the following: `(2) In any
case in which any of the other persons referred to in paragraph (1)(B) is entitled
to monthly benefits as a divorced spouse under subsection (b) or (c) of section
202 for any month, the benefit to which'; and
(2) by
striking subparagraph (B).
SEC. 2. EFFECTIVE DATE.
The amendments made by section 1 shall apply with respect to benefits for months
after the date of the enactment of this Act.
